Miloš Grujić, Head of the Department of the Subspecialist Cabinets at the Center for Radiation Oncology at University Clinical Center Kragujevac, shared on LinkedIn:

“I am pleased to share our latest publication in Cancers MDPI.

Selected Blood-Accessible Biomarkers in Prostate Cancer Radiotherapy: A PRISMA-ScR Timing-Window Framework Beyond PSA

In this scoping review, we explored the current clinical evidence on blood-accessible biomarkers in prostate cancer radiotherapy and highlighted an often-overlooked aspect: the timing of blood sampling.

Our findings suggest that different biomarkers follow different biological kinetics, meaning that a single sampling schedule may not be appropriate for all biomarkers. We hope this work will contribute to more standardized biomarker research and support future studies in precision radiation oncology.
